DESCRIPTION:

Duties: Perform ad-hoc analytical support to the Mortgage finance/business heads in the form of profitability analytics, trend analysis, and capital optimization. Run the quarterly mortgage stress-testing model, create associated reporting & analytics, and present results to senior management. Run quarterly CECL reserve setting model, and analyze and present key drivers of quarter-over-quarter variances. Perform ad-hoc analysis and derive credit costs results for credit risk leadership team to understand and explain modeled results from mortgage credit analytics. Actively interact with the stress testing model team to understand, develop and enhance forecast frameworks for the mortgage business. Provide analytical insight while considering the business problem of mortgage revenue, credit and prepayment risks. Ensure that reserve and stress test executions comply with regulatory requirements and the firm wide Model Risk Policy. Design, develop and maintain analytic applications needed for change estimation, forecasting, and model performance monitoring.

QUALIFICATIONS:

Minimum education and experience required: Master's degree in Applied Statistics and Data Analytics, Applied Economics, Finance, Statistics or related quantitative field of study plus 3 years of experience in the job offered or as Quant Analytics, Model Development Associate, Actuarial Data Analyst, or related occupation.

Skills Required: Requires experience in the following: Programming using SAS and SQL; Manipulating large datasets in database systems such as SQL or Hadoop; Credit or lending life cycle experience including loan origination, credit risk modeling and loss forecasting; Summarizing large datasets in Excel using nested if statements, pivot tables and lookup functions; Model implementation or execution, including UAT testing and model maintenance; and Statistical data analysis using MATLAB, R, Python or SAS.
